Nathan Ryan Martindale, 23, of Bloomington, MN, passed away unexpectedly on December 26, 2022.
Nathan was born on January 29, 1999 to Ryan Martindale and Jennifer Siedow in Burnsville, MN. Nathan graduated from Stillwater High School in 2017. He went on to study business at California State University San Marcos and graduated with a Bachelor of Science Business Administration with a minor in finance.
Nathan was the oldest of three children. He loved sports- both playing and watching- including hockey, golf, football and baseball. He enjoyed watching the sunset at Sunset Cliffs and walking around Rodeo Drive in Los Angeles. He loved to work out. He adored his younger brothers and his cat Ash.
Nathan is survived by his parents, Jennifer (Chris) Siedow and Ryan (Nikki) Martindale; brothers, Nicholas and Andrew Martindale; grandparents, John and Adrienne Deblon and Barb Martindale; step brothers, Alex (Kaylie) Siedow, Matt Siedow, and Jack Siedow; and cousin, Sara Zeigler. Nathan was greeted in heaven by his grandfather, Bill Martindale; and uncle, Shawn Martindale; along with his beloved dog, Jake.
In lieu of flowers, donations may be made in Nathan's memory to Youth Advantage (https://youthadvantage.org/). Nathan was an avid sports fan and participant. Youth Advantage helps kids in the Stillwater Schools area with financial assistance to participate in athletics, arts, and educational-enrichment opportunities.
